2.4. Qualification of staff
Assembly, commissioning, operation, maintenance, decom-
missioning and disposal may only be carried out by qualified
staff. Work on electrical parts may only be carried out by a
trained electrician in accordance with the applicable regula-
tions and directives. Other activities in connection with the
ISYGLT module, such as assembly and installation of system
components with tested standard plug connections, as well
as operation and configuration of the ISYGLT module may
only be carried out by trained staff.
2.5. Changes to the product
Unauthorized modifications to the ISYGLT module which are
not described in this or the other applicable instructions can
lead to malfunctions and are prohibited for safety reasons.
2.6. Use of spare parts and additional equipment
The module may be damaged if unsuitable spare parts and
additional equipment are used. Only use original spare parts
and additional equipment from the manufacturer.

2. Safety instructions
Observe the following general safety instructions when installing
and commissioning the device:
Assembly and installation of the ISYGLT module may only be car-
ried out by a qualified electrician. Other activities in connection
with the ISYGLT module, such as assembly and installation of
system components with tested standard plug connections, as
well as operation and configuration of the ISYGLT module may
only be carried out by trained staff.
Observe the electrical installation regulations of the country in
which the device is installed and operated as well as its natio-
nal accident prevention regulations. In addition, observe internal
company regulations (work, operating and safety regulations).
Before working on the ISYGLT module system, it must be
disconnected from the power supply and secured against
being switched on again. After completion of the assem-
bly, installation and maintenance work, an electrical check
must be carried out! Check all protective conductor con-
nections and the voltages at all connection plugs as well
as at each individual module slot.
2.1. Intended usage
The module is exclusively suitable for regulation (control) in
conjunction with ISYGLT system components. Any other use
is not intended. The limit values stated in the technical data
must not be exceeded under any circumstances. This applies
in particular to the permissible ambient temperature range
and the permissible IP protection type. For applications with
a higher required IP protection type, the ISYGLT module must
be installed in a housing or a cabinet with a higher IP protec-
tion type.
2.2. Predictable mishandling
The module must not be used in the following cases in par-
ticular:
•explosive area
When operating in explosive areas, sparking can lead to defla-
gration, fire or explosions.
